Meaning, pronunciation, translations and examples WebSep 6, 2024 · While “flaunt” and “flout” are often confused, they have different meanings: Flaunt means to show something off to gain admiration. Flout means to intentionally ignore a law, rule, or convention. To remember which word you should use, it might help to imagine a rich aunt fl aunt ing her wealth, since the word “aunt” appears in ...

From Longman Dictionary of Contemporary English flout /flaʊt/ verb [ transitive] to deliberately disobey a law, rule etc, without trying to hide what you are doing Some companies flout the rules and employ children as young as seven. deliberately/openly flout something The union had openly flouted the law. see thesaurus at disobey → ...
